About 3 Dunster Avenue
3 Dunster Avenue is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Rochdale (OL11 3RD). It has a recorded floor area of 146 m² (around 1572 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(September 2014)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in December 2013 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good; while lighting d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from September 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a basement. Period features are noted in the property record.
It hasn't traded since March 2004, a hold of 22 years that's notably long for the area. Today's modelled estimate of £177,000 sits 164.2% above the 2004 sale of £67,000.
